#150f0e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#150f0e is composed of 8.2% red, 5.9%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 28.6% magenta, 33.3% yellow and 91.8% black. It has a hue angle of 8.6 degrees, a saturation of 20% and a lightness of 6.9%. #150f0e color hex could be obtained by blending #2a1e1c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000000.

#150f0e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#150f0e has RGB values of R:21, G:15, B:14 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.29, Y:0.33, K:0.92. Its decimal value is 1380110.
